Output d630db9124667052d8aa84772f5ef8ce3de3bc56d12f26499cda2627f5496ac9:0

value
670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 677c683c90c307d51177e0e38b0f2ad05d5598df OP_EQUAL
address
3B8CZGHK4x76rR62QF9GNVXh8EMjWQ2XXL
transaction
d630db9124667052d8aa84772f5ef8ce3de3bc56d12f26499cda2627f5496ac9